Operis Analysis Kit 5.4
Contents
|
Index
|
Search
Getting started with OAK
Welcome to OAK
What's new in OAK 5
General caution
OAK Help
Three ways to get help
Updating OAK help
Example spreadsheets
International spelling
Applications for OAK
Simple spreadsheets
Developing spreadsheet models
Understanding other people's models
Formally auditing spreadsheets
Parallel reconstruction
Code inspection
Reconciling to a template model
Installing OAK
Getting the OAK software
Simple installation
The Add-Ins Manager
Buying and Activating OAK
Operis Hub portal
Subscription mechanism
Checking for updates
In case of problems
Using OAK
OAK menus
Main menus
Context menu
Accelerator key and Keytips
OAK commands
Map
Compare | Workbooks
Compare | Worksheets
Compare | Ranges
Compare | Remove Compare Modifications
Names | Redefine names
Names | Recreate names
Names | Apply names
Names | Deapply names
Names | Remove #REF! names
Names | Delete names in cells
Names | Localize names in cells
Names | Build name database
Formula | Formula Walker
Formula | Reconstruct
Formula | Optimize
Formula | Prune inactive path
Formula | Fan Out Precedents
Search Overview
Search | Arrays
Search | Dynamic Arrays
Search | Merged cells
Search | Primary error cells
Search | Hardcoded constants
Search | Constant formula cells
Search | Unreferenced cells
Search | Conditional search
Search | References to blank cell
Summarize
Worksheets | Columns and Rows | Insert
Worksheets | Columns and Rows | Delete
Cells | Transpose
Cells | Copy Address
Cells | Copy Literal
Worksheets | Remove Color Formatting
Cells | Unhide rows and columns
Worksheets | Worksheet Manager
Introduction
Managing Worksheets
Type Name for Sheets
Worksheet Manager Options
Settings
Shortcuts
Utilities | Colors
Utilities | Casing
Utilities | Jump
Utilities | Switch Signs
Utilities | Convert References
Reference material
Basic concepts in Excel
Multi-area ranges
Seven ways to identify a cell's precedents
Used range
One-Cell Rule
Merged cells
Arrays
Excel 365 Dynamic Arrays
Excel Names
If you use Excel names
If you avoid Excel names
Names tutorial A: Getting started
Names tutorial B: Defining names
Names tutorial C: Using names in formulas
Names tutorial D: Names adjustment
Names tutorial E: Apply names
Names tutorial F: Names that identify several cells
Names tutorial G: Create names
Names tutorial H: Useful conventions
Names tutorial I: Row and column matching
Names tutorial J: Aggregation
Names tutorial K: Controlling aggregation
Names tutorial L: Naming constants
Names tutorial M: Fine print
Names tutorial N: Summary
Basic concepts in OAK
Expression Simplification
Simplification rules
Expression Pruning
Pruning rules
Difference between simplifying and pruning formulas
Discrepancy Analysis
Fan out
Constraining discrepancy analysis
Expression pruning in discrepancy analysis
Large ranges
Associating references or values
Suppressing unmatched subtrees
Formula reconstruction
Reconstructing multi-sheet formulas
The context of a reconstruction
Reconstructing whole calculations
Timelines in reconstructions
Frozen rows and columns
Reconstructing formulas that use names
Levels of Reconstruction
Lots of levels
Mixed levels
Left-right consistency
Simplifying reconstructions
Pruning reconstructions
Reconstructing SUMs
Selections suitable for reconstruction
Long formulas
Uses for reconstructions
Difference between reconstruction and discrepancy analysis
Formula denaming
Spreadsheet quality
Nesting
OFFSET and INDIRECT
Obsolete lookups
IFERROR
Hardcoded constants
Cell reference notation
Cell reference profligacy
Error constants
OAK 4 Scripting Reference
Scripting with the OAK 4 API
Getting started in scripting
Making scripting faster
OAK methods in the object browser
Script example: Finding redundant spreadsheets
Colors in compare and map commands
OAK 4 object reference
AnalyzeDiscrepancies
ApplyNames
BuildNameDatabase
Compare
CompareAlignment
CompareContent
CompareRanges
CompareRangesWithColors
CompareWithColors
CompareWorkbooks
CompareWorksheets
CopyAddress
CopyLiteral
DeapplyNames
DeleteNamesInCells
DeleteRowsOrColumns
DelinkMode
FormatAddress
FormatAddressDelimiter
GetVersion
ICompareResult
IDeapplyNamesResult
InsertRowsOrColumns
IOAKAddIn
IOAKAPI
IRenameFailure
IRenameResult
LocalizeNamesInCells
Map
MapColor
MapComponents
MapOutput
OAKResult
Operis_OAK
OptimizationMode
Optimize
Prune
PruningMode
Reconstruct
ReconstructionReportTitles
RecreateNames
RedefineName
Reformulate
RemoveColorFormatting
RemoveHashRefNames
RenameErrorType
SearchFor
SearchForArrays
SearchForConstantFormula
SearchForDynamicArrays
SearchForHardcodedConstant
SearchForMerged
SearchForPrimaryError
SearchForReferencesToBlankCells
SearchForUnreferencedCells
SearchForValue
ShowProgress
Summarize
Transpose
UndoCompareModifications
UnhideCells
WorksheetManager
Known limitations
3-D references
Doubly prefixed references
Deleting corrupt names
Problem solving
Forcing preinstallation testing
Reporting bugs
Logs
Finding where OAK is installed
Disabled Items
OAK Registry Settings
Per-User COM Registration
Per-Machine COM Registration
COM/OLE Blocking
Context Menus Persist after uninstallation
Resources
Eusprig
Ray Panko's spreadsheet research website
Microsoft Excel blog
Version histories
OAK version history
Version history for this help
© 1997-2022 Operis Business Engineering Limited